What do you think are the best liquid fert or best combination of some ferts? If it matters I am setting up a 10gal planted guppy breeding tank with a combination of swords, val, java fern etc. Just looking for oppinons.
 
For a tank that size I would go with the Flurish line of products. But I see that most of the plants that you list are going to grow way too big for a 10 gallon. Swords alone can grow huge and depending on what kind of val you have they could overtake a tank in no time. I had some vals that had some 50-60" leaves and cavered the surface of a 125 gallon tank. Stick with small plants and go with the Flurish and you should be good to go. How about lighting and co2?
 
i was also planing on doing a 30gal planted with some dwarf cichlids. i am going to do a a diy yeast co2 system. i dont know wat kind of lighting i have i havent looked at it in a while. coould u recommend a group of plants for a ten gallon? also i found there are lots of different types of flourish which ones should i use?
 
Which one to use... depends on several things. Light is the first thing. Do you just have the standard strip light that comes on the tank or have you up graded? If its just the standard light might not need any ferts other then what the fish supply. I need some more info to advise further. Info I could use... How much light does the tank have or will have? What kind of Substrate? Water out of tap GH, KH, PH? If you do co2 then your KH PH values will give you your co2 level.

Plants for a 10 gallon. Hmm... in small tanks I like to use alot of different crypts just make sure they are not something like crypt spirials as they will get too big so with something like one of the colors of Wendtii Red, Geen, etc. I also use dwarf sag., micro sword, glosso, java moss, willow moss, and java fern, just to name a few.
